Tulowitzki returns with five hits: Troy Tulowitzki had a career-high five hits in his first game back since slamming his bat in frustration July 4, sending shards of wood into his right hand. Tulowitzki, who came off the 15-day DL on Monday, received 16 stitches at the base of his right index finger. "Anytime you get any hits it's nice, let alone five," Tulowitzki said. "You know, we lost the game tonight, and that's the main thing I look at." (Updated 07/22/2008).

Tulowitzki was reinstated from the 15-day disabled list Monday, taking his spot at shortstop against the Los Angeles Dodgers. Tulowitzki needed 16 stitches after hammering his maple bat into the ground in frustration on the Fourth of July, sending shards of wood into his hand. (Updated 07/21/2008)
Advice
The 23-year-old returns to the team hitting .166 with three homers and 16 RBIs. Last season, he led the Rockies to their first World Series with a stellar rookie season, finishing second in the NL Rookie of the Year race and being rewarded with a new contract.
